    Scrolling the Protests. A Glimpse at the Screen of a Reporter Covering Black Lives Matter Protests in the U.S.

    After an estimated 26 million people participated in the protests, the Black Lives Matter movement has become one of the largest in the U.S. history. The highly diverse group has been able to cultivate a dialogue as a unified voice to call out against the racial inequality and police brutality, which plagues American law enforcement to this day. This has become too widespread even for the elected officials to ignore.

    Screenlifer’s investigative reporter covers the movement from the front lines of the protests and dives into the deeper issue of America’s systematic racism.
